## Vendoring Fonts — Release Step 4 (Glyphden)

Before each Glyphden release, the third-party fonts in `vendor/fonts/` must be re-fetched from the approved mirror and checked against the manifest. Support should verify that license files travel with every font family and that no stray weights were pulled in. Once the directory is clean, the packaging script bundles the fonts and signs the archive so downstream installs can trust it. The signing key used for this step is shown below.

deploy key for kajof-fajop: bky6_gDHw9Q

## Authentication

Before the SQL linter (we call it Squiggle) will run, it needs to talk to our schema registry. The linter enforces uppercase keywords, snake_case table names, and no `SELECT *` in committed files — CI will block you otherwise. To authenticate Squiggle against the registry, drop the key below into your local env file.

service key, tadup-tahog: zpat7_wB1tnEL

## Formula sandbox tuning

User-supplied formulas in Gridmoor execute inside a restricted interpreter with hard ceilings on time, memory, and call depth. Reviewers should confirm any change to these ceilings is justified in the PR description, since raising them widens the abuse surface. Defaults were chosen from production traces. The current limits are as follows.

limits module of tafog-fawip:
WEIGHTS = {
    "julix": 57,
    "lamys": 992,
    "kasvan": 209,
    "quenok": 750,
    "alddor": 259,
    "oliath": 1009,
    "wenix": 815,
}

### Step 4: Migrate flag definitions to Togglewright 2

Move each flag from the legacy YAML registry into the Togglewright 2 manifest. Rollout percentages now live per-environment; the old global field is ignored. Reviewers: reject any PR that keeps both registries active, since evaluation order becomes undefined. Kill switches must be declared explicitly — they no longer default on. After the manifest lands, the evaluator sidecar must be restarted with these settings:

service settings:
quenath:
  log_level: info
  metrics_host: metrics.quenath.tolvaqlabs.internal
  pin: 1407
  pool_size: 8